    Coach 1053 on this train here was actually built by Hawker Siddeley, and is actually a primordial ancestor of the Bombardier Bi-Level, built to different standards long before Bombardier bought out the coach design. 1053 was originally built for GO Transit in 1978, and later sold to TRE in 1997.

      The ridership is comparable to other commuter rail services in Texas, but hardly in the rest of the US. It's mainly because the service frequency combined with the lack of external connections makes it difficult for the TRE to compete with systems in say Chicago or LA.

      Sadly the Burlington station in Wichita Falls was demolished as was the MKT(Katy) station in Waco and in San Antonio. However the Missouri Pacific and Southern Pacific stations in San Antonio have been renovated, although not being used by Amtrak. The Southern Pacific station in El Paso has also been renovated, it is a charmer... Amtrak is making do with a more modern modest station in Houston, San Antonio, and Fort Worth...
